A library for reading/writing non octet aligned values such as 1-bit boolean or 17-bit unsigned int.

No methods supplied for floating-point types.
- You need to prepare an instance of
ByteInputfor reading octets. - You can read bits from an instance of
BitInputwhich uses theByteInputinstance.
Prepare an instance of ByteInput from various sources.
new ArrayByteInput(byte[], int);
new BufferByteInput(java.nio.ByteBuffer);
new DataByteInput(java.io.DataInput);
new StreamByteInput(java.io.InputStream);Construct with an already existing ByteInput.
final BitInput bitInput = new DefalutBitInput(byteInput);final BitInput input;
final boolean b = input.readBoolean(); // 1-bit boolean 1 1
final int ui6 = input.readInt(true, 6); // 6-bit unsigned int 6 7
final long sl47 = input.readLong(false, 47); // 47-bit signed long 47 54
final long discarded = input.align(1); // aligns to (1*8)-bit 2 56

final BitOutput output;
output.writeBoolean(false); // 1-bit boolean 1 1
output.writeInt(false, 9, -72); // 9-bit signed int 9 10
output.writeBoolean(true); // 1-bit boolean 1 11
output.writeLong(true, 33, 99L); // 33-bit unsigned long 33 44
final long padded = output.align(4); // aligns to (4*8)-bit 20 64
